目录
v2ray简介
v2ray是一款功能强大的网络代理工具,广泛用于科学上网、翻墙以及安全上网等场景。它通过多种协议支持流量的传输,使得用户能够绕过地域限制,访问全球内容。
v2ray的特点
- 多协议支持:v2ray支持VMess、VLess、Shadowsocks等协议,可以根据需要选择不同的协议以保证最佳的网络性能。
- 强大的隐匿性:v2ray采用多重加密算法,增强了流量的安全性和隐匿性。
- 高效的流量管理:v2ray能够有效管理流量,避免网络拥堵,提高使用效率。
v2ray的工作原理
v2ray的工作原理主要基于客户端与服务器之间的代理通信。具体来说,v2ray的流量通过加密隧道进行传输,确保通信内容的隐私性和安全性。
v2ray的流量转发
v2ray通过协议转换和流量分发技术,将用户的请求转发到目标服务器,获取响应并返回给用户。其工作流程如下:
- 客户端发起请求
- v2ray客户端将请求加密后发送给v2ray服务器
- v2ray服务器进行解密、处理请求,并转发到目标网站
- 响应通过v2ray服务器加密后返回给客户端
这种加密、转发的方式有效避免了流量被监测或干扰。
v2ray安装教程
安装v2ray前,首先需要确认系统的环境要求,v2ray支持多种操作系统,包括Windows、Linux、macOS等。以下是Windows系统的安装教程。
Windows安装步骤
- 前往v2ray官方GitHub下载最新版本的v2ray。
- 解压下载的压缩包到指定目录。
- 打开命令行窗口,进入v2ray的安装目录。
- 运行
v2ray.exe
命令启动v2ray服务。 - 配置v2ray的客户端和服务器。
Linux安装步骤
-
打开终端,使用以下命令安装v2ray: bash bash <(curl -L -s https://install.direct/go.sh)
-
完成安装后,使用以下命令启动v2ray: bash systemctl start v2ray
v2ray配置步骤
配置v2ray主要包括客户端配置和服务器配置。以下是配置过程中的一些关键步骤。
配置v2ray客户端
- 打开v2ray的配置文件
config.json
。 - 在
inbounds
部分配置客户端的端口和协议。 - 在
outbounds
部分配置服务器的连接信息,确保协议、加密方式等设置正确。 - 保存配置并重启v2ray客户端。
配置v2ray服务器
- 登录到服务器,找到v2ray的配置文件
config.json
。 - 设置服务器的端口、协议、加密方式等参数。
- 确保客户端与服务器之间的配置信息一致。
- 启动v2ray服务器,确保服务正常运行。
如何通过v2ray跑流量
v2ray不仅能够提供科学上网服务,还能通过其高效的流量管理功能,让用户合理分配和控制流量。
使用v2ray跑流量的步骤
- 确保v2ray客户端与服务器配置正确,并且能够正常连接。
- 配置v2ray的流量控制规则,指定哪些流量需要走v2ray代理。
- 配置v2ray的多路径协议,优化不同应用的流量分发。
- 启动v2ray并检查流量是否正确转发。
流量监控与分析
v2ray提供了流量监控工具,帮助用户实时监控网络流量,分析流量来源和去向。
v2ray的常见问题解答
1. 为什么v2ray无法连接?
- 确认客户端和服务器的配置是否一致。
- 检查网络连接是否正常,确保没有被防火墙或其他安全软件拦截。
- 尝试重启v2ray服务或客户端。
2. v2ray连接速度慢怎么办?
- 确保选择了合适的协议和加密方式。
- 检查服务器是否存在性能瓶颈,可以考虑更换服务器或调整服务器配置。
- 使用v2ray的流量分发功能,将流量合理分配到不同的路径。
3. 如何避免v2ray被封锁?
- 使用更为隐蔽的协议,如VLess或Trojan。
- 配置v2ray的伪装功能,使流量看起来像正常的HTTPS流量。
- 尝试更换服务器或使用CDN加速服务。
总结
v2ray作为一款强大的网络代理工具,不仅支持多种协议和加密方式,还具备高效的流量管理功能。通过正确的安装与配置,用户可以有效地通过v2ray实现流量转发、科学上网以及网络安全保护。遇到常见问题时,通过调整配置或优化网络设置,可以获得更好的使用体验。
希望本文能够帮助您全面了解v2ray的使用方法,顺利实现流量管理和科学上网需求。
正文完